Off-Road Vehicles (Registration) Bill

To make provision for the establishment of a compulsory registration scheme for off-road vehicles; and forconnected purposes.

In progress Current stage: Money resolution (Commons)

The story so farThe Off-Road Vehicles (Registration) Bill was introduced in the House of Commons on 13 December 2006 by Graham Stringer (Labour). It is now at the "Money resolution" stage in the House of Commons.

Progress through Parliament

  1. 1st reading Commons 13 Dec 2006
  2. 2nd reading Commons 2 Mar 2007
  3. Committee stage Commons 20 Jun to 11 Jul 2007
  4. Money resolution Commons 26 Jun 2007
